Common Roofing Materials Used in Broken Arrow
Choosing the right roofing material is vital for durability, energy efficiency, and aesthetic appeal in Broken Arrow. Here’s an overview of the most popular options and how they perform in Oklahoma’s climate.
Material | Average Lifespan | Cost Range | Benefits | Considerations |
---|---|---|---|---|
Asphalt Shingles | 15-30 years | $100-$150 per sq. | Affordable, good wind resistance, easy to install | May fade under intense sun, moderate maintenance needed |
Metal Roofing | 40-70 years | $300-$700 per sq. | Long lifespan, reflective, excellent storm resistance | Higher upfront cost, noisy during rain without insulation |
Wood Shingles/Shakes | 20-40 years | $400-$700 per sq. | Natural appearance, good insulation value | Requires regular maintenance, fire risk in dry seasons |
Clay or Concrete Tiles | 50+ years | $600-$1200 per sq. | Very durable, fire-resistant, great for curb appeal | Heavy, may require roof reinforcement, costly installation |
Slate | 75-100 years | $1000-$2000 per sq. | Extremely durable, luxurious appearance | Very heavy, high installation cost |
Signs You Need Roof Repair or Replacement
Broken Arrow homeowners should watch for early warning signs to avoid costly damage. Timely roof repair or replacement extends your roof’s lifespan and protects your home’s structural integrity.
- Missing or curling shingles: Exposure to wind and sun can cause shingles to deteriorate, leading to leaks.
- Granule loss: Excessive granules in gutters suggest shingle aging and reduced protective capability.
- Water stains or leaks: Interior stains on ceilings often indicate roof vulnerabilities.
- Roof age: Most asphalt roofs last 15-25 years; approaching this age is a replacement signal.
- Damaged flashing: Torn or rusted flashing around chimneys or vents can cause leaks.
- Moss or algae growth: While common, it can hold moisture against roofing and damage shingles.
- Structural damage: Sagging or visibly warped roof sections require immediate professional inspection.
Navigating Broken Arrow Roofing Permits and Codes
Proper permits and adherence to city building codes are essential for safe and legal roofing projects. In Broken Arrow, roofing permits typically apply for replacements, repairs exceeding a specific scope, or structural upgrades.
The city requires compliance with the latest International Residential Code (IRC) and amendments that address local weather risks, such as tornadoes and hail. Pro tip: licensed roofing contractors usually handle permit acquisition, ensuring all work passes inspections.
Homeowners should verify the roofing contractor’s license and insurance status before hiring, as this safeguards against liability and ensures code compliance.
Roof Maintenance Tips for Broken Arrow Homes
Regular maintenance is key to maximizing your roof’s lifespan and performance against Broken Arrow’s weather extremes. Follow these best practices to protect your roof investment.
- Schedule annual professional roof inspections to identify and fix minor issues before they escalate.
- Clean gutters and downspouts seasonally to prevent water backup and ice dam formation.
- Trim overhanging tree branches that can scrape or drop debris on roofing materials.
- Check attic ventilation to reduce heat buildup and moisture accumulation that degrade roofing materials.
- Promptly repair minor leaks or damaged shingles to avoid mold growth and structural damage.
- Use reflective coatings or lighter-colored roofing materials to combat Oklahoma’s intense summer heat and lower energy costs.
How to Choose the Right Roofing Contractor in Broken Arrow
Selecting a trustworthy roofing contractor ensures quality work, warranty protection, and peace of mind. Consider these factors when hiring roofing professionals locally.
- Check credentials: Confirm licensing, insurance, and bonding relevant to Oklahoma and Broken Arrow regulations.
- Look for local experience: Contractors familiar with the city’s climate and building codes deliver superior results.
- Request references and reviews: Positive customer feedback demonstrates reliability and workmanship quality.
- Verify warranty offerings: Good contractors guarantee their work and roofing materials.
- Get detailed written estimates: Compare prices, timelines, and materials provided.
- Confirm permit handling: Professional roofers manage necessary licenses and inspections.

Frequently Asked Questions About Broken Arrow Roofing
How long does a typical asphalt shingle roof last in Broken Arrow?
Asphalt shingle roofs generally last 15-25 years, depending on quality, installation, and maintenance. Oklahoma’s weather, including heat and hail, influences lifespan, so routine inspections help maximize durability.
Do I need a permit for a roof repair in Broken Arrow?
Small repairs typically don’t require permits, but extensive repairs or full roof replacements do. Confirm requirements with the city’s building department or your contractor.
What is the average cost of a roof replacement in Broken Arrow?
Costs vary based on materials and roof size but range from $5,000 to $15,000 for typical residential asphalt shingle roofs. Metal and tile roofs are more expensive due to materials and installation complexity.
Can metal roofing help reduce energy bills in Broken Arrow?
Yes, metal roofs reflect sunlight and reduce heat absorption, lowering cooling costs during Oklahoma’s hot summers. Proper insulation further enhances energy efficiency.
How often should I have my roof inspected?
Annual inspections are recommended, plus after severe weather events. Regular checks help detect problems early and extend your roof’s service life.
